#CD8C55 Hex Color Code

#CD8C55

The Hexadecimal Color #CD8C55 is a contrast shade of Peru. #CD8C55 RGB value is rgb(205, 140, 85). RGB Color Model of #CD8C55 consists of 80% red, 54% green and 33% blue. HSL color Mode of #CD8C55 has 28°(degrees) Hue, 55% Saturation and 57% Lightness. #CD8C55 color has an wavelength of 602.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CD8C55 is #FF9966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CD8C55 is #C85. The Closest Color to #CD8C55 is #CD853F. Official Name of #CD8C55 Hex Code is Twine.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CD8C55 is 0 Cyan 32 Magenta 59 Yellow 20 Black and #CD8C55 CMY is 0, 32, 59.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CD8C55 is hsl(28,55,57,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(28, 59,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CD8C55 is 36.2, 32.39, 12.94.
Hex8 Value of #CD8C55 is #CD8C55FF. Decimal Value of #CD8C55 is 13470805 and Octal Value of #CD8C55 is 63306125. Binary Value of #CD8C55 is 11001101, 10001100, 1010101 and Android of #CD8C55 is 4291660885 / 0xffcd8c55.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CD8C55 is 0.444, 0.397, 0.397 and YIQ Color Space of #CD8C55 is 153.165, 56.405, -3.3685.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CD8C55 is 38.34, 29.59, 13.27.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CD8C55 is 63.66, 19.05, 39.02.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CD8C55 is 63.66, 49.93, 42.54.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CD8C55 is 63.66, 43.42, 63.98. Hunter Lab variable of #CD8C55 is 56.91, 13.94, 26.36.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CD8C55

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
